It should work for that. These newer versions of DM(L) do not need a disk in the drive any more for most games. The loader no longer has anything to do with that part. DM(L) just sets itself up based on whether there is a disk in the drive or not so any loader should work.

DML and DM both create a specific save file for each game on your SD card. Devolution creates one 16mb memory card file. The DML and DM so far can only be used in those programs but the one Devolution makes can be used in the Dolphin Emulator or if you do end up buying a gc memory card you can copy your saves to it using GCMM (gamecube memory card manager).

So I'm a bit confused. In 2.1 I can no longer disable no disc? I want to always use a disc to ensure maximum compatibility.
If you have a disc on drive, it will use it to improve compatibility. That's automatic now.
Ok thanks for the replies guys. Now just waiting for a GX update from cyan.
Basically, anything newer than DML v1.0 did it that way. They just basically ignored the nodisk option whether it was set or not. They just set it depending if the disk was in the drive so changing the NoDisk option in a loader only did something if you were using something before DML r59.

Now, any loader is still compatible with DM v2.1. You just have to remember that where there's a setting that says "NoDisk" it actually means "Force Widescreen" since that new option uses the enable/disable bit that was previously used for the NoDisk patch.

I think, basically, you use the option like this:
NoDisk ENABLED = Forced Widescreen ON
NoDisk DISABLED= Forced Widescreen OFF
Unless the loader has been updated with a separate option. In that case it just detects the DM version and chooses which option to ignore.
